DMZ Insider Tour: NK Defector Q&A, 3rd Tunnel & Bridge options
Meet a North Korean defector in our immersive North Korea Experience Center. Hear firsthand stories of daily life, escape, and resettlement, followed by a live Q&A. An immersive space designed to give visitors a deeper understanding of life across the border.
Explore Korea’s DMZ Step inside** the 3rd Invasion Tunnel**, a hidden passage once built by North Korea for a surprise attack. Then visit Dora Observatory, where you can look across the border into North Korean territory.
Enhance your tour with optional add-ons at booking: Visit the Red Suspension Bridge at Lake Majang or Mt. Gamaksan, both connected to Korean War history and now offering breathtaking panoramic views.
Free hotel pick-up is included for groups of 10 or more

Reviews summaryOur guide was Paul, super friendly and charismatic, and he made the tour enjoyable. We first went to the viewpoints, and even though we couldn't take photos, our guide shared his with us. Then we went to the tunnel, and I warn you that tall people will have a hard time bending down, and generally, what goes down must come up, so it's tiring. They even recommend not wearing a jacket because you'll eventually feel hot. The downside again is that you can't record. Afterward, they take you to a restaurant for lunch, but I chose to bring my own food and sat in the park; there's also a restroom nearby. Finally, we went to the bridge, which was really cool, but be prepared for a strenuous climb up the mountain.
